Secrecy Information Transmission Optimization of MIMO System
This paper studies the Semidefinite Relaxation (SDR) precoding technique and applies it into MIMO system to minimize the transmission power with a certain secrecy channel capacity. In this paper, the null space precoding algorithm and the Taylor precoding algorithm are introduced and compared. The simulation results demonstrate that in the MIMO eavesdropping model, Taylor precoding algorithm can achieve the minimum transmitting power with a certain safety channel capacity. Based on the advantages and disadvantages of the two precoding algorithms in terms of computational complexity and optimization performance, we propose to combine the two precoding algorithms to obtain the optimal solution and greatly reduce the simulation time.
